Vibrant living in North Charleston, SC

Charleston, South Carolina, is one of the most beautiful Southern cities. The metropolitan seaport maintains its charm as a historic city dating back 300 years. As the third largest city in South Carolina, North Charleston shares the name of its southern neighbor, but is an urban area of its own. Since 2000, North Charleston’s population has grown by more than 54%! The vibrant living in North Charleston, SC, continues to attract people to move to this exciting city.

Here are some of the reasons we love living here.

The really great “great outdoors”

Riverfront Park is one of the biggest perks of living in North Charleston. Situated on the former Charleston Naval Base, this sprawling green space features an 800-foot boardwalk along the Cooper River, a fishing pier, playground, walking trails, amphitheater, and dog park. Riverfront Park hosts the annual July 4th fireworks and the National Outdoor Sculpture Competition and Exhibition, as well as a long list of festivals.

Wanamaker County Park provides 1,015 acres of woodlands and wetlands, carefully preserved and protected. Throughout the park, however, you’ll find ways to enjoy the natural surroundings, like biking trails, sand volleyball, disc golf, horseshoes, and picnic spaces, as well as playgrounds, splash areas, and dog parks.

The schedule of live performances at North Charleston Coliseum spans musical genres, from country and rock to orchestra. Broadway musicals, stand-up comedy, WWE wrestling, and South Carolina Stingrays hockey games all take place here. Riverfront Park is another great venue for live performances all year long.

Are theme parks your thing? Frankie’s Fun Park is your destination in North Charleston. Thrill-seeking rides, arcade, virtual reality game, a climbing wall, go karts, mini golf, driving range, batting cage, and bumper boats add up to a great time. Whirlin’ Waters Adventure Waterpark presents another place to cool off, with 15 acres of wet and experiences.

North Charleston is a piece of American history.

The North Charleston and American LaFrance Fire Museum is a popular place for history buffs. When you look at trucks and equipment dating back to the mid-1700s and learn the dangers of firefighting, you’ll gain new respect for the people who battle fires!

For a deeper dive into local history, check out The Hunley Project. The H.L. Hunley is a submarine that disappeared in 1864. The sub was found and raised again. Like a time capsule, the ship’s artifacts have been carefully restored.

A foodie’s favorite

The influx of new people in North Charleston has also expanded our already-diverse menu of eateries. From organic and vegan menus to every type of cultural cuisine, you have an endless choice of restaurants to explore.

The North Charleston Farmers Market gives you access to farm-fresh produce, baked goods, and other locally sourced products.

Do you appreciate a unique craft brew? You’ll love North Charleston! Holy City Brewing, Rusty Bull Brewing, Freehouse Brewery, Commonhouse Aleworks, Frothy Beard Brewing Company, and Coast Brewing will quench your thirst.
